Eyewinkers, Tumbleturds, and Candlebugs: The Art of Elizabeth Talford Scott
Baltimore Museum of Art, 12 November 2023 - 28 April 2024

Eyewinkers, Tumbleturds, and Candlebugs: The Art of Elizabeth Talford Scott: Baltimore Museum of Art

Past exhibition
Elizabeth Talford Scott , Plantation, 1980

Plantation, 1980

Cotton ground, cotton, wool, synthetic blend appliqué, cotton and silk embroidery threads, metal needle, cotton lining
68.5 x 74.5 in. (174 x 189.2 cm)

© The Estate of Elizabeth Talford Scott at Goya Contemporary / TALP

Courtesy Goya Contemporary Gallery, Baltimore.

Collection of the Baltimore Museum of Art, MD
